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
395775328 23 022
4498294 93625129627
4498294 93625129627
1285868 488875834 885 65628521
All about undefined
Interested in learning more?
4498294 93625129627
1285868 488875834 885 65628521
See more
34769 5577
138629766 9525 366117
See more
153908656 1557894599 52
18 2732 368061799 23 73668188
See more